Answer: The school board wants you to answer C) Agricultural Revolution, but that is incorrect.

The correct answer would be during the Neolithic Era, so none of the choices would be the right answer.

Explanation: During the Paleolithic Era, which corresponds to the old stone age, people were hunter-gatherers.  This means that they obtained food by hunting animals and by gathering fruits, vegetables, and nuts from local plants.  So options A and B are pretty much the same thing and incorrect.

Domestication and pastoralism developed during the Neolithic or new stone age when people discovered that, if they took care of certain plants, they would grow again and give them more food.  Domestication is not the same thing as agriculture (even though the school system continues to teach it this way).

The Agricultural Revolution actually refers to a much later period in history, during the 18th century in Britain, when traditional agriculture went through a process of transformation.  This is way after domestication and pastoralism.  

Finally, option D is also incorrect because classical civilizations like Greece and Rome already had full-scale agriculture and had already gone through the process of domestication and pastoralism.

The civil service system is much better than the alternative, which was Patronage. as implemented by the Hoover Commission. Civil service sets employment competence standards for hiring and makes working a permanent career, not just until the next election. it was so outstandingly successful, that virtually every state and community government follows it to large extent.

People who have a sturdy feel of self efficacy are rapid to cope with troubles alternatively than stewing and brooding about them.

Self-efficacy refers to an individual's faith in his or her capacity to execute behaviors necessary to produce unique overall performance attainments (Bandura, 1977, 1986, 1997). Self-efficacy reflects self assurance in the potential to exert control over one's very own motivation, behavior, and social environment.

<h3>What is self-efficacy mindset?</h3>

Self-efficacy in the tutorial realm is the faith and confidence that one has in regard to his or her capability to accomplish significant studying duties and produce the favored effects (Brozo & Flynn, 2008). Perseverance refers to the tendency to pursue long-term desires with sustained effort and tough work.
